Metals Become Stronger and More Flexible with Just a Momentary Electric Current

A research group from Kumamoto University and others has developed a new method that significantly strengthens titanium alloys with just a few milliseconds of pulsed current treatment. This method utilizes non-thermal effects, reducing energy consumption by over 50% while increasing toughness by up to 30%. Applications in aircraft structural materials and artificial joints are expected.
